Melissa Barrera Faces Industry Backlash for UNRWA Fundraiser Amid Gaza Conflict
The actress's social media advocacy for Palestine has led to heated debates within her talent agency and management company, with discussions on potentially terminating her contracts.
- Melissa Barrera, known for her roles in 'In the Heights' and 'Scream', faced potential firing from her agency and management company after promoting a UNRWA fundraiser for Palestine on Instagram.
- The controversy arises amid allegations of UNRWA staff involvement in Hamas attacks, leading several countries, including the U.S., to freeze funding to the agency.
- Barrera's posts, which aimed to raise funds for 'martyrs in Gaza and the West Bank', have raised over $60,000 despite the backlash.
- Previously fired from 'Scream VII' for pro-Palestine posts, Barrera's recent actions have reignited discussions on her representation by WME and Sugar23.
- The actress's advocacy has significantly increased her social media following, doubling her Instagram followers to 1.5 million.
